What is the effect of hysterectomy on the body

The main effects on the body after removal of the uterus are the following: First, if you remove the uterus, you lose your fertility. The uterus is the organ of female conception. If the uterus is removed, there is no place to conceive a baby and there is no fertility. No menstruation, women’s menstruation because the endometrium is affected by the hormonal changes of the ovaries to occur cyclical shedding, after hysterectomy will not have menstruation. The uterus is a part of the pelvic floor. Without the support of the uterus, the symptoms of pelvic floor and vaginal laxity will increase, which will have an impact on sexual life.
